On Sunday, August 27, 2023, World Church of Messiah’s choral group The Messiah Choir held a charity concert at the Osaka City Central Public Hall. This makes it the second charity concert held by the group following a concert held in Atami in December 2022.
All the funds raised with the help of the audience of over 300 people and the proceeds from ticket sales have been donated to the Japanese Red Cross Society.
The Messiah Choir wishes for song and music to bring comfort and peace to the hearts of people and will continue to carry out various activities with the aim of contributing to the public interest through the betterment of the human spirit through musical activities.
